Changed my propshaft bolts last week at my mate's garage. While it was all apart, we had a good look at the flexible coupling, and it was in mint condition.
We also dropped the centre heat shield and the centre bearing to see if we could see anything that could lead to the screaming I have heard in heavy rain. Once again, nothing untoward, so we secured it back into place for a bit of a test.

I then "drove" the car with it lifted off the ground while my mate squirted water directly into the centre bearing to see if we could get it Tao make any noise. Other than traction control/Haldex not liking it very much, we had no unusual noises created.

Centre bearing was then dried off and given a good squirt with spray grease - I know not ideal, but better than nothing, and maybe if it is water creating an issue, the grease may keep the water out for a bit.

All put back together, and running smoothly thus far.
